Skip to content

Commit

Permalink
print/psutils: Sanitize MANPREFIX
Browse files Browse the repository at this point in the history
Approved by:    portmgr (blanket)
  • Loading branch information
5u623l20 committed Jan 22, 2024
1 parent 9357f7e commit 9eda29d
Show file tree
Hide file tree
Showing 3 changed files with 22 additions and 23 deletions.
3 changes: 1 addition & 2 deletions print/psutils/Makefile
@@ -1,6 +1,6 @@
PORTNAME= psutils
PORTVERSION= 1.17
PORTREVISION= 5
PORTREVISION= 6
CATEGORIES= print
MASTER_SITES= ftp://ftp.dcs.ed.ac.uk/pub/ajcd/ \
ftp://ftp.knackered.org/pub/psutils/ \
Expand Down Expand Up @@ -28,7 +28,6 @@ MAKE_ENV+= CHMOD="${CHMOD}" \
PERL="${PERL}"
SCRIPTS_ENV+= CC=${CC} \
DATADIR=${DATADIR} \
MANPREFIX=${MANPREFIX} \
PAPER=dummy \
PERL5=${PERL}

Expand Down
2 changes: 1 addition & 1 deletion print/psutils/files/patch-Makefile.unix
Expand Up @@ -22,7 +22,7 @@
INSTALLMAN = install -c -m $(MANMODE)
MANEXT = 1
-MANDIR = /usr/local/share/man/man$(MANEXT)
+MANDIR ?= $(DESTDIR)$(MANPREFIX)/man/man$(MANEXT)
+MANDIR ?= $(DESTDIR)$(PREFIX)/share/man/man$(MANEXT)

-CC = gcc
-CFLAGS = -DPAPER=\"$(PAPER)\" -DUNIX -O -Wall
Expand Down
40 changes: 20 additions & 20 deletions print/psutils/pkg-plist
Expand Up @@ -19,25 +19,25 @@ bin/extractres
bin/includeres
bin/psmerge
bin/showchar
man/man1/epsffit.1.gz
man/man1/extractres.1.gz
man/man1/fixdlsrps.1.gz
man/man1/fixfmps.1.gz
man/man1/fixmacps.1.gz
man/man1/fixpsditps.1.gz
man/man1/fixpspps.1.gz
man/man1/fixscribeps.1.gz
man/man1/fixtpps.1.gz
man/man1/fixwfwps.1.gz
man/man1/fixwpps.1.gz
man/man1/fixwwps.1.gz
man/man1/getafm.1.gz
man/man1/includeres.1.gz
man/man1/psbook.1.gz
man/man1/psmerge.1.gz
man/man1/psnup.1.gz
man/man1/psresize.1.gz
man/man1/psselect.1.gz
man/man1/pstops.1.gz
share/man/man1/epsffit.1.gz
share/man/man1/extractres.1.gz
share/man/man1/fixdlsrps.1.gz
share/man/man1/fixfmps.1.gz
share/man/man1/fixmacps.1.gz
share/man/man1/fixpsditps.1.gz
share/man/man1/fixpspps.1.gz
share/man/man1/fixscribeps.1.gz
share/man/man1/fixtpps.1.gz
share/man/man1/fixwfwps.1.gz
share/man/man1/fixwpps.1.gz
share/man/man1/fixwwps.1.gz
share/man/man1/getafm.1.gz
share/man/man1/includeres.1.gz
share/man/man1/psbook.1.gz
share/man/man1/psmerge.1.gz
share/man/man1/psnup.1.gz
share/man/man1/psresize.1.gz
share/man/man1/psselect.1.gz
share/man/man1/pstops.1.gz
%%DATADIR%%/md68_0.ps
%%DATADIR%%/md71_0.ps

0 comments on commit 9eda29d

Please sign in to comment.